Long-term Goals represent your final desired outcome regarding your basic difficulties with anxiety. Often there are several Short-term Goals for each Long-term Goal. Constipation is the state wherein there is decrease in the frequency of excreting body waste which can be associated with inability to pass out stools or there is a presence of hardened stool that is difficult to excrete.
